A comprehensive waste material fermentation waste gas treatment mechanism
The transmission structure that drives the rotating wheel and fan blades through the rotating shaft achieves uniform delivery of exhaust gas. The filter plate can be easily replaced using the locking pin and telescopic spring rod structure, which solves the problems of uneven gas delivery and laborious disassembly, and improves the efficiency and convenience of garbage exhaust gas treatment.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of waste gas treatment technology, specifically a waste gas treatment mechanism for integrated waste fermentation. Background Technology
[0002] Garbage is solid waste generated in human daily life and production. Due to its large volume, complex and diverse composition, and its polluting, resource-related, and social characteristics, it requires harmless, resource-recovery, volume-reduction, and socialized treatment. If it is not properly treated, it will pollute the environment, affect environmental sanitation, waste resources, undermine production and living safety, and disrupt social harmony. Garbage disposal aims to quickly remove garbage, treat it harmlessly, and finally make it reasonable.
[0003] A search revealed a Chinese patent (CN215654671U) that includes a housing and an air supply box. The air supply box and the housing's air inlet are connected by a connecting pipe. Nozzles are installed on the upper and lower parts of the housing's inner wall, with the nozzles positioned above the air inlet. Inside the housing, a rotating shaft has a mounting frame, and an absorption plate is installed within the mounting frame. The absorption plate is secured to the mounting frame with snap-fit fasteners. The rotating shaft is connected to a drive motor. A first filter plate and a second filter plate, both arc-shaped, are respectively located above the rotating shaft. An air outlet is located at the top of the housing, and a water outlet is located at the bottom. This invention maximizes the utilization of the absorption plate by mounting it on the rotating shaft, effectively absorbing impurities in the waste gas. The nozzles atomize the purifying agent, ensuring it reacts fully with the waste gas, thus improving the device's waste gas treatment efficiency.
[0004] The aforementioned patent proposes to use an adsorption plate mounted on a rotating shaft to maximize its utilization and absorb impurities in the waste gas. By setting nozzles, the purifying agent is atomized and fully reacts with the waste gas, improving the device's waste gas treatment efficiency. The adsorption plate is installed in the mounting frame with clips, facilitating its replacement and cleaning. However, this mechanism lacks a stable gas delivery device, making it difficult to ensure uniform gas filtration. Furthermore, disassembling the filter plate is quite laborious. Therefore, we propose a comprehensive waste gas treatment mechanism for waste fermentation. Utility Model Content
[0005] One of the technical problems this application aims to solve is that without a stable gas delivery device, it is difficult to ensure that the gas can be filtered evenly, and at the same time, the filter plate is difficult to disassemble.

[0016] This utility model has at least the following beneficial effects: 1. The waste gas from the waste fermentation process is transported to the treatment chamber through the air inlet pipe. At the same time, after the motor starts, it drives multiple rotating wheels through the shaft. The rotating wheels then drive multiple fan blades to swing through the figure-eight belt. This transmission structure ensures that the waste gas is evenly transported to multiple gas filter plates for thorough filtration and decomposition. The wastewater generated by decomposition can be discharged in time through the drain pipe, effectively ensuring the uniformity and thoroughness of waste gas filtration and significantly improving the treatment effect of waste gas from waste fermentation.
[0017] 2. The structure, which releases the locking pin from the locking block by rotating the rotating rod and provides a reaction force with the telescopic spring rod, causes the gas filter plate to automatically pop out when it is no longer fixed by the stop bar. This allows workers to quickly remove and replace the gas filter plate. While ensuring the stability of the mechanism, it effectively reduces the workload of workers in disassembly and replacement, greatly improves the convenience of gas filter plate maintenance and replacement, and ensures that the subsequent exhaust gas treatment work of the equipment can be efficiently connected. [0026] Based on the above embodiments, the following is the complete working principle of the above embodiments: When waste gas filtration is required, the waste gas is transported into the interior of the processing chamber 1 through two air inlet pipes 9. The motor 2 starts and drives multiple rotating wheels 4 to rotate through the rotating shaft 3. At the same time, the multiple rotating wheels 4 rotate and drive multiple fan blades 6 to swing through the figure-eight belt 8, so that the waste gas is evenly transported to multiple gas filter plates 13 for filtration and decomposition. The decomposed wastewater is discharged through the drain pipe 10, ensuring that the waste gas can be fully and evenly filtered. When the gas filter plate 13 needs to be replaced after long-term operation, the locking pin 20 and the locking block 17 are released by rotating the rotating rod 19. At this time, the gas filter plate 13 can be taken out. Since the two telescopic spring rods 15 provide reaction force, the gas filter plate 13 will automatically pop out when the stop bar 16 is released, which makes it convenient for workers to quickly take out the gas filter plate 13 without affecting the firmness and reducing the workload of workers.
